The Influence of Geography on Oklahoma’s Weather

Oklahoma’s geography plays a significant role in determining its weather patterns. Situated in the heart of North America, it lies at the crossroads of several major air masses. The state’s relatively flat terrain, punctuated by the Wichita Mountains in the southwest and the Ozark Mountains in the southeast, allows for unimpeded movement of air masses, leading to rapid weather changes. The proximity to the Gulf of Mexico provides a source of moisture, fueling severe thunderstorms and precipitation events. Meanwhile, the influence of the Rocky Mountains to the west creates a rain shadow effect, impacting precipitation patterns across the state.

The Role of Air Masses

The interaction of various air masses is a key driver of Oklahoma’s weather. Warm, moist air from the Gulf of Mexico frequently clashes with cooler, drier air masses from the north and west. This collision can create instability in the atmosphere, triggering the development of severe thunderstorms, hailstorms, and tornadoes. The jet stream, a high-altitude river of wind, also plays a vital role, steering these air masses and influencing the intensity and location of severe weather events.

Seasonal Weather Patterns in Oklahoma

Oklahoma experiences distinct seasonal variations in its weather. Spring and summer are characterized by warm temperatures, high humidity, and the potential for severe thunderstorms and tornadoes. Autumn brings cooler temperatures and a gradual decrease in rainfall. Winter can be surprisingly unpredictable, with occasional bouts of freezing rain, snow, and even blizzards, particularly in the northern and western parts of the state.

Spring (March-May): Tornado Season

Spring is widely considered Oklahoma’s most dangerous season due to the high frequency of tornadoes. The combination of warm, moist air from the Gulf of Mexico and cooler, dry air from the west creates ideal conditions for the formation of supercell thunderstorms, which are responsible for the majority of tornadoes. The state’s location within Tornado Alley further exacerbates the risk, making preparedness and awareness essential during this time of year.

Summer (June-August): Heat and Humidity

Summer in Oklahoma is hot and humid, with temperatures frequently exceeding 90°F (32°C). The high humidity levels can make the heat feel even more oppressive. Thunderstorms are common, often occurring in the afternoon and evening hours as the sun heats the ground and creates instability in the atmosphere. These thunderstorms can produce heavy rainfall, strong winds, and occasionally hail.

Autumn (September-November): Mild Temperatures and Changing Leaves

Autumn offers a pleasant respite from the summer heat and humidity. Temperatures gradually cool down, and the foliage turns vibrant colors before the leaves fall. Rainfall is generally less frequent than in spring and summer, making it a relatively dry season. However, occasional cold fronts can bring cooler temperatures and even a few early winter storms.

Winter (December-February): Unexpected Snow and Ice

While many associate Oklahoma with tornadoes, winter can bring its own set of challenges. While not always snowy, Oklahoma experiences periods of freezing temperatures, ice storms, and occasional snowfall, particularly in the northern and western regions. These winter storms can disrupt travel, cause power outages, and create hazardous driving conditions.

Understanding Severe Weather in Oklahoma

Oklahoma is unfortunately well-known for its severe weather events. Understanding the different types of severe weather is crucial for staying safe. This includes:

Tornadoes

Tornadoes are violently rotating columns of air extending from a thunderstorm to the ground. They are characterized by their destructive winds, which can reach speeds of over 300 mph. Oklahoma’s location within Tornado Alley makes it highly susceptible to tornadoes, and understanding the warning systems and safety procedures is vital.

Hailstorms

Hailstorms are thunderstorms that produce hailstones, which are balls of ice that can range in size from small pellets to golf balls or even larger. Large hailstones can cause significant damage to property and crops.

Flash Floods

Flash floods are sudden, rapid rises in water levels, often caused by heavy rainfall in a short period. They can occur in low-lying areas and near rivers and streams, and they can be incredibly dangerous.

Blizzards

While less common than other severe weather events, blizzards can occur in Oklahoma, particularly in the northern and western parts of the state. Blizzards are characterized by heavy snowfall, strong winds, and low visibility, making travel extremely hazardous.

Preparing for Oklahoma Weather

Preparation is key to staying safe during Oklahoma’s unpredictable weather. Here are some essential tips:

  • Develop a weather preparedness plan: This should include knowing where to seek shelter during severe weather, having emergency supplies on hand, and having a communication plan with family and friends.
  • Monitor weather forecasts regularly: Stay informed about upcoming weather events through reliable sources like the National Weather Service.
  • Have an emergency kit: This should include essential supplies such as water, food, batteries, a first-aid kit, and a weather radio.
  • Know your community’s warning systems: Understand how your local authorities will alert you to severe weather warnings and what actions to take.
  • Build a safe room or shelter: If you live in an area prone to severe weather, consider building a safe room or shelter to protect yourself and your family during a severe weather event.
